Early computers like the Z1 predominantly utilized mechanical relays for their operational functions. The Z1, created by Konrad Zuse, was built in the 1930s and represents one of the first programmable binary computers. It used mechanical components to carry out computations, with relays functioning as switches that could open and close circuits to represent binary states (on/off).

Mechanical relays were essential to the design of early computing devices, facilitating not only arithmetic operations but also logic operations by manipulating electrical signals through physical movement. As technology progressed, subsequent generations of computers transitioned to using vacuum tubes, transistors, and eventually silicon chips, but the Z1's reliance on mechanical relays marks a significant stage in the evolution of computer technology.
